| /* Get the last modification time of the driftfile */ |
| |
| static time_t |
| get_driftfile_time(void) |
| { |
| struct stat buf; |
| char *drift_file; |
| |
| drift_file = CNF_GetDriftFile(); |
| if (!drift_file) |
| return 0; |
| |
| if (stat(drift_file, &buf)) |
| return 0; |
| |
| return buf.st_mtime; |
| } |
| |
| /* ================================================== */ |
| /* Set the system time to the driftfile time if it's in the future */ |
| |
| static void |
| apply_driftfile_time(time_t t) |
| { |
| struct timespec now; |
| |
| LCL_ReadCookedTime(&now, NULL); |
| |
| if (now.tv_sec < t) { |
| if (LCL_ApplyStepOffset(now.tv_sec - t)) |
| LOG(LOGS_INFO, "System time restored from driftfile"); |
| } |
| } |
| |
| /* ================================================== */ |
| |
| void |
| RTC_Initialise(int initial_set) |
| { |
| time_t driftfile_time; |
| char *file_name; |
| |
| /* If the -s option was specified, try to do an initial read of the RTC and |
| set the system time to it. Also, read the last modification time of the |
| driftfile (i.e. system time when chronyd was previously stopped) and set |
| the system time to it if it's in the future to bring the clock closer to |
| the true time when the RTC is broken (e.g. it has no battery), is missing, |
| or there is no RTC driver. */ |
| if (initial_set) { |
| driftfile_time = get_driftfile_time(); |
| |
| if (driver.time_pre_init && driver.time_pre_init(driftfile_time)) { |
| driver_preinit_ok = 1; |
| } else { |
| driver_preinit_ok = 0; |
| if (driftfile_time) |
| apply_driftfile_time(driftfile_time); |
| } |
| } |
| |
| driver_initialised = 0; |
| |
| /* This is how we tell whether the user wants to load the RTC |
| driver, if he is on a machine where it is an option. */ |
| file_name = CNF_GetRtcFile(); |
| |
| if (file_name) { |
| if (CNF_GetRtcSync()) { |
| LOG_FATAL("rtcfile directive cannot be used with rtcsync"); |
| } |
| |
| if (driver.init) { |
| if ((driver.init)()) { |
| driver_initialised = 1; |
| } else { |
| LOG(LOGS_ERR, "RTC driver could not be initialised"); |
| } |
| } else { |
| LOG(LOGS_ERR, "RTC not supported on this operating system"); |
| } |
| } |
| } |

| /* Start the processing to get a single measurement from the real time |
| clock, and use it to trim the system time, based on knowing the |
| drift rate of the RTC and the error the last time we set it. If the |
| TimePreInit routine has succeeded, we can be sure that the trim required |
| is not *too* large. |
| |
| We are called with a hook to a function to be called after the |
| initialisation is complete. We also call this if we cannot do the |
| initialisation. */ |
| |
| void |
| RTC_TimeInit(void (*after_hook)(void *), void *anything) |
| { |
| if (driver_initialised && driver_preinit_ok) { |
| (driver.time_init)(after_hook, anything); |
| } else { |
| (after_hook)(anything); |
| } |
| } |
